GHIT 0265:  Kyle Lockrow Upcoming Professional Racing Driver
Kyle is a racing driver who has worked his way from a grassroots racing hobby to a professional career that has reached the NASCAR level.  We had the opportunity to talk with him about his history and how amateur racing and especially amateur endurance racing has helped him progress and improve to the national level.  His story is still being written, but after meeting him, we are huge fans and wish him nothing but the best.  If that story isn’t inspiring enough, he did this in spite of racing with (our good friends at) Race Bar

Highlights from this episode include:
1)  We learn how Kyle has transitioned from amateur racing to being involved with NASCAR.  Believe it or not, racing our junk race cars has actually helped Kyle progress.
2)  What can you learn from amateur racing that transfers to higher levels and even the professional level.
3)  Kyle asks us about what our training regimen is and surprisingly, we actually had an answer he liked.
4)  Kyle's schedule for 2022 is still to be finalized, but it sounds like a very busy year for him.
5)  How amateur endurance taught Kyle how to pass and be passed, as well as sharpens his ability to race other cars. 
6)  Several of the differences between professional racing and amateur racing.  Surprisingly, some of the pro's can even learn a few things from our amateur teams that would help them on a race weekend.
